Understanding Hidden Camera Detection Techniques
Hidden cameras, often used for malicious purposes such as invasion of privacy or surveillance, pose a significant concern, especially in domestic settings like homes and places of work. Detecting these devices requires a blend of technological tools and keen observation. One critical area of focus is understanding hidden camera detection techniques that can expose these covert devices.
A primary method involves utilizing specialized equipment designed to detect electromagnetic radiation emitted by cameras, including infrared signals. Experts in this field employ thermal imaging cameras, which visualize heat signatures, to identify unusual temperature patterns indicative of hidden cameras. Additionally, physical inspections and a keen eye for detail are invaluable. Professionals suggest regularly checking for any unusual hardware, cables, or devices that might be attached to walls, ceilings, or furniture. The presence of multiple power outlets near a single area, for instance, could signal the covert installation of a camera. By combining these techniques, individuals can significantly enhance their ability to detect hidden cameras and ensure a safer living or working environment.

Advanced Tools for Uncovering Hidden Devices
In the realm of hidden monitoring device signal detection, advanced tools have emerged as powerful allies for those seeking to uncover clandestine surveillance equipment, such as hidden cameras. While the primary goal remains ensuring privacy and safety—especially when employing these techniques on trusted individuals like babysitters—the methods employed require a nuanced approach that respects ethical boundaries while achieving results. One such tool is the use of RF (radio frequency) detection devices, which can identify signals from hidden cameras, motion detectors, and audio bugs, offering a comprehensive solution for thorough inspection.

Legal Rights and Ethical Considerations for Parents
Parents often turn to hidden monitoring devices out of concern for their children’s safety, particularly when hiring babysitters. However, legal rights and ethical considerations must guide this practice to ensure it remains within acceptable boundaries. While hidden cameras can help identify problematic situations, such as abuse or neglect, their use is subject to privacy laws that vary across jurisdictions. For instance, in many regions, placing cameras in areas where reasonable expectation of privacy exists, like a babysitter’s bag or personal belongings, is illegal without consent.
Ethical implications further complicate the matter. Installing hidden cameras can create an atmosphere of distrust, potentially damaging the parent-child relationship and the babysitter’s sense of security. To navigate these complexities, parents should familiarize themselves with local laws and consider alternative strategies for ensuring babysitter reliability.
Practical measures include thorough background checks, verifying references, and establishing clear rules and expectations from the outset. Natural detection methods, like actively observing interactions or using trusted neighbors for periodic checks, can be more effective than hidden cameras in fostering an environment where bad behavior is less likely to occur. Ultimately, striking a balance between parental concern and respect for privacy and ethics is paramount for maintaining healthy family dynamics and legal integrity.
